Vince <fuzzy77@free.fr> writes:
> I see the following bug since I've enabled packet writing for my dvd
> drive (using the udftools package):
>
> - eject won't open the tray unless I'm root
>
> - whether I'm root or not, I get the following error when running eject:
> "eject: unable to eject, last error: Invalid argument"
> and in the system logs:
> "program eject is using a deprecated SCSI ioctl, please convert it to SG_IO"
>
> The command: pktsetup dvd /dev/cdrom ; eject
> should allow anyone with a cd/dvd writer to reproduce this bug.
>
> Disabling packet writing ("pktsetup -d dvd") solves the problem and
> everything works fine (no strange message in the logs).
I can't reproduce any of these problems on my laptop. I run FC3 and
kernel 2.6.10-rc3-bk6. I tried both with a USB CDRW drive and an IDE
DVD+RW drive.
More info is needed. What distribution? What kernel? And please
provide strace logs from eject when it fails.
